Tecumseh, NE Next Destination for Extreme Bullriding Tour

By Cindy Meyers, Rodeo Attitude
Posted Tuesday, August 5, 2008

e-mail E-mail this page   print Printer-friendly page

The Extreme Bullriding Tour is headed for its annual stop in Tecumseh, NE, August 9th. The event will once again be hosted by the Johnson County Ag and Mechanical Society at the Johnson County fairgrounds. The tour will be bringing to town the riders of the National Federation of Professional Bullriders (NFPB) and the Bullriders Of America (BOA) along with the bulls of the Double S Bull Company for a battle of man against beast. To spice up the night 4 men will match their wits and skill in a one on one match-up with the lean, meaning fighting bulls of the Double S Bull Company in a freestyle bullfighting competition sanctioned by the Midwest Bullfighters Association.

 

This is a special event for the bull riders as they will not only be competing for the $2000 added money, but this event is a double point event toward winning the 2008 Extreme Bullriding Tour Championship and the M & M Custom Camper the champion will receive along with the Frontier Trophy Championship Buckle and other prizes. The champion of this event will also receive the much sought after Jerry Nolte Memorial Buckle made by Frontier Trophy Buckles and given each year by White Buffalo Productions in honor of the well known rodeo judge and rodeo supporter who called Tecumseh home for so many years. For the last two years Jimmy Twedt has won this event and all eyes will be on him to see if he can make it three in a row.

Straight from his appearance at the Bullriders of America Finals where he was honored as the Barrelman of the Finals and Specialty Act of the Finals will be Hugo, Oklahoma’s Allan Dessel performing the acts that won him this prestigious award. Announcing the event and playing straight man for Allan will be Russ Warren of Owensville, MO.

 

Action will begin at 7 PM and there will be food and a beer garden on the premises.
